Mustafa Ali is new PAS sec-gen

June 11, 2009

KUALA LUMPUR, 11 June 2009: Datuk Mustafa Ali was appointed PAS secretary-general today, replacing Datuk Kamaruddin Jaafar, who did not wish to be re-appointed. The decision to appoint Mustafa, who was previously the party’s election director, was made during its central working committee meeting today, the first after the weekend party elections. 11 H1N1 cases; M’sia “ready to face pandemic”, says Liow

June 11, 2009

PETALING JAYA, 11 June 2009: Malaysia confirmed another two new Influenza A (H1N1) cases today, bringing the total so far to 11. No reason for Kuan Yew to meet me: Mahathir

June 11, 2009

KUALA LUMPUR, 11 June 2009: Former prime minister Tun Dr Mahathir Mohamad said today he did not see any reason why Singapore’s Minister Mentor Lee Kuan Yew would want to see him. New name for trade, consumer affairs ministry

June 11, 2009

KUANTAN, 11 June 2009: The Ministry of Domestic Trade and Consumer Affairs is now known as the Ministry of Domestic Trade, Cooperative and Consumerism.
